Not equal are those believers remaining at home - other than the disabled - and the mujāhideen, who strive and fight in the cause of Allāh with their wealth and their lives. Allāh has preferred the mujāhideen through their wealth and their lives over those who remain behind, by degrees. And to all i.e., both Allāh has promised the best reward. But Allāh has preferred the mujāhideen over those who remain behind with a great reward -
